When interacting with the exterior environment, living organisms need to be able to clearly identify unsafe stimuli and respond to them within an correct way. This important process is carried out through the nociceptors which make up a A part of the somatosensory anxious system. These nociceptors reply to hazardous or perhaps tissue-harmful stimuli and transmit stimuli through the pores and skin, muscles, joints, and viscera [three]. Nociceptors are classified in accordance with the attributes of their axons, which are frequently divided into two types: unmyelinated (C fibers) or a bit myelinated (Aδ fibers).

There are actually commonly a few principal levels from the notion of pain. The very first stage is pain sensitivity, followed by the 2nd phase wherever the signals are transmitted in the periphery to your dorsal horn (DH), which is situated from the spinal cord through the peripheral nervous system (PNS). Finally, the third stage will be to carry out the transmission in the signals to the higher Mind by means of the central anxious program (CNS). Normally, There are 2 routes for signal transmissions being done: ascending and descending pathways. The pathway that goes upward carrying sensory information and facts from the body through the spinal wire towards the Mind is defined as the ascending pathway, Whilst the nerves that goes downward through the brain to your reflex organs by means of the spinal wire is named the descending pathway.
